DJ Professor K broadcasts the Jet Set Radio pirate radio station to gangs of youths who roam Tokyo-to, skating and spraying graffiti. One gang, the GGs, competes for turf with the all-female Love Shockers in the shopping districts of Shibuya-Cho, the cyborg Noise Tanks in the Benten entertainment district, and the kaiju-loving Poison Jam in the Kogane dockyard. The authorities, led by Captain Onishima, pursue the gangs with riot police and military armaments. After the GGs defeat Poison Jam, Noise Tanks, and Love Shockers in turf wars, they each drop a piece of a mysterious vinyl record. Professor K says that the mysterious vinyl has the power to summon a demon.

Most of the propagators (especially if you look on tiktok) are rather clueless, there is no nostalgia in there, rather approaching something that used to be the cream of cringe with a fresh (again clueless) perspective.
I suppose this could have been said about previous styles or subcultures, but this seems to really be everything before blended together. Looking at people who are into it seems more like navigating a space, rather than assigning specific traits to a specific group.
You can pretend to recognise the more scruffy youths from the more emo femboy youths, the true religion post-chief keef youths, the post-metalhead youths,
yes, but in reality they all overlap so heavily that they all exist within the same multidimensional space.
